Review on PJRC Teensy 2 0 by Edward Freeland

Revainrating 4 out of 5

Very small and powerful for its size

I bought this Teensy to reprogram an old keyboard for use on a modern computer . Due to its small size, it is particularly easy to install in the housing without getting in the way. The software from Teensy website is extremely easy to use, all you have to do is select the .hex file and click the download button. There is an option to download the .hex file from the command line if you prefer. My only real complaint is that Teensy uses a mini USB connector. The mini-USB cable is a lot harder to find these days (in mainstream stores, at least) as it has almost entirely been superseded by the smaller, more robust micro-USB standard. Jumper wires to solder on Teensy, it will be easier to solder than soldering a bare wire in. Overall this is a great product and I haven't had any issues with it. If you need a controller that can be used in a small space, Teensy will serve you well. With that in mind, however, there are cheaper alternatives like the Arduino Leonardo if you need to use an ATMega32U microcontroller and don't have strict space-saving requirements.
